Empowering Tomorrow's Talents: Supporting Young Musicians Through Comprehensive Education

A key element that distinguishes the Chamber Music Festival is its unwavering commitment to nurturing young musical talent. Up to 50 gifted young Mexican musicians converge in San Miguel for a transformative two-week programme centred around mentorship. These aspiring artists stay with local families while honing their skills through master classes</b led by experienced performers. This remarkable initiative not only enhances the festival experience but also plays a pivotal role in cultivating the next generation of musical talent in Mexico, providing them with invaluable insights and exposure to the enchanting world of music.

This educational effort culminates in free concerts held at venues such as Bellas Artes and the Sala Quetzal at the Bíblioteca Pública, where these talented musicians have the opportunity to share their passion for music with the local community. You may also encounter spontaneous performances in the lively Jardín, where the joyous sounds of music fill the air, beautifully exemplifying the fruitful collaboration between local families and budding artists.

Feast of Santo Domingo: Embark on a Meaningful Spiritual Journey

The Feast of Santo Domingo, celebrated on August 8, invites you into a space of profound spiritual reflection and celebration. Hosted in the magnificent church dedicated to Santo Domingo, this event pays tribute to the founder of the Dominican Order. You will be captivated by the vibrant processions, heartfelt prayers, and lively music, all contributing to an atmosphere of devotion that embodies the community's deep faith and respect for its rich cultural heritage.

Dia del Bombero: A Joyous Celebration Honouring Local Heroes

On August 22, the Dia del Bombero transforms the streets of San Miguel into an exhilarating celebration dedicated to honouring firefighters. Anticipate the sound of roaring sirens, a spirited parade, and an outpouring of gratitude for the brave heroes who risk their lives to protect the community. This thrilling day is filled with excitement and appreciation, showcasing the camaraderie and pride of local residents as they unite to honour their heroes.

Navigating the Rainy Season: Embrace the Elements with Joy

The rainy season in San Miguel typically features short, refreshing afternoon showers that last for an hour or two. Instead of seeing this weather as a hindrance, embrace its unique charm that adds depth to your experience. Carry a light raincoat or umbrella, enabling you to enjoy outdoor concerts and festivities without worry. Locals quickly adapt, transforming rain into opportunities for spontaneous fun, whether by dancing in the rain or sharing stories in cosy cafés.
